I have twiddled with my mockup (other mockup). I have implemented:

  • Faded out the contact dialogue so that Mission Objective is the most emphasized template
  • Replaced "Mission Objective" at the top of the template with the actual mission objective (tentative suggestion)
  • Left-aligned the mission objectives inside the template
  • Made Ambush and Clue thinner than Mission Objective and Contact Dialogue to de-emphasize them
  • Centered and basically-matched NPC Text width with Ambush and Clue (slightly smaller boxes at high resolution -- use of {{hidden}} makes it hard to match exactly)
  • Changed "Unnecessary Solicitation" to "Check-In Text" (aka "Still Busy Dialogue" in MA, but the wiki uses "busy" to mean "too many missions open" already, which would make "Still Busy" confusing)

Regarding white space, none of the other boxes (except maybe MeritAward) have content that works all on one line. They all really need their descriptive titles. There isn't actually a lot of white space unless there are short sentences within a box (creating right-side white space).
